Bonaire Employment-Based Immigrant Visa Categories in Georgia

Georgia employment-based immigrant visa petitions — categorized as EB-1, EB-2, and EB-3 visas — are made to allow experienced workers from around the world to contribute to the U.S. economy. Each classification has its own requirements and is designed for different skill sets and qualifications.

EB-1 Immigration Attorneys in Bonaire, GA

The EB-1 employment-based immigrant visas in Bonaire are reserved for individuals with extraordinary abilities in their field, multinational managers or executives, and outstanding professors or researchers. This extremely selective visa category is designated for those who have achieved significant contributions to their industry of field of expertise. These applicants do not have to get a labor certification.

Georgia Immigration Attorneys for EB-2 Employment-Based Immigrant Visas

EB-2 green cards are designed specifically for people with advanced degrees or exceptional abilities in the sciences, arts, or business. Applicants in Georgia must meet specific eligibility criteria and often require sponsorship from an employer. The employer must be able to sponsor the individual and demonstrate that no qualified U.S. workers are available for the role. However, some qualified applicants may also qualify for a National Interest Waiver (NIW), without an employer sponsorship.

Immigration Attorneys for EB-3 Employment Based Green Cards in Bonaire, GA

EB-3 are designed for professional workers, skilled employees, and other workers who have less specialized education or skills than may be needed for other employment-based immigration categories. The EB-3 employment-based immigrant visa accommodates a broader spectrum of applicants, from janitors and au-pairs to healthcare aids and construction workers. Applicants must go through a labor certification process to apply for this category.
